Analog Devices Inc. (ADI) is a leading global semiconductor manufacturer focused on analog and mixed-signal integrated circuits for industrial, automotive, and communications end markets. As of May 1, 2026, ADI trades at a current price of $402.26, representing a 3.33% gain in recent trading sessions.
